What they do

A Training and Development Manager manages staff training and professional development programs for an employer. Develops training programs that address staff needs and support the strategic goals of a company or organization. Supervises training staff and partners and evaluates training impact.

Job Description

Learning & Development Manager Framingham, MA | $90,000-$120,000 Base + Benefits A growing multi-site organization is looking for an experienced Learning & Development Manager to lead employee training and development across its field operations. This is not a traditional corporate L&D position. The person stepping into this role will work closely with operational leaders, manage Regional Trainers, strengthen onboarding and certification programs, and spend meaningful time in the field ensuring training translates into stronger employee and operational performance. Reporting directly to the Chief Operating Officer , this position offers significant visibility and ownership across the organization. What You'll Be Doing Manage and develop Regional Trainers supporting multiple markets Lead company-wide onboarding, training, and certification initiatives Improve training programs based on operational needs and employee performance Work directly with field leadership to identify skill and performance gaps Visit locations regularly to evaluate training execution and provide coaching Support expansion, new-location openings, and operational initiatives Monitor training metrics, employee development, certification progress, and onboarding effectiveness Build scalable programs that support internal advancement, engagement, and retention What We're Looking For 5+ years of learning & development, training, employee development, or operational leadership experience Proven experience leading and developing people Experience supporting employees across multiple locations, markets, or regions Strong experience with onboarding, training programs, coaching, and frontline employee development Background in retail, automotive, consumer services, hospitality, restaurant, or another multi-unit environment preferred Strong facilitation, presentation, communication, and project-management skills Comfortable working in active field environments Ability to travel extensively, including overnight travel Valid driver's license What Makes This Role Attractive Reports directly to the COO Broad ownership of Learning & Development across the organization Direct leadership of Regional Trainers High level of exposure to operational and executive leadership Ability to build and improve programs rather than simply administer training Significant influence over employee development, performance, and retention Combination of strategy, people leadership, and field execution MOHR Talent is an equal-opportunity employer and complies with all applicable federal, state, and local nondiscrimination laws.
